Transaction 19565c11766bae7e97ecbba1fc7600e80efa73a020e95e85a9d7b6947aefa07b

20 Input
2 Outputs
  • 19565c11766bae7e97ecbba1fc7600e80efa73a020e95e85a9d7b6947aefa07b:0
  • value  113798095
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 19565c11766bae7e97ecbba1fc7600e80efa73a020e95e85a9d7b6947aefa07b:1
  • value  696255
    address  17CfERLXdymKTp784w3nkJmVHEPR1SJMD3